Materials
The original pattern was done in 1 color and called for 5 skeins (8 oz) of solid color or 6 skeins variegated. I wanted to add color plus increase the size of the afghan so I used: - Approx. 3 7oz skeins each - Redheart yarn 4ply worsted weight - 3 colors of your choosing - Hook size J-10 (6mm)
